url: --noproxy option overrides NO_PROXY environment variable

Under condition using http_proxy env var, noproxy list was the
combination of --noproxy option and NO_PROXY env var previously. Since
this commit, --noproxy option overrides NO_PROXY environment variable
even if use http_proxy env var.

Closes #1140

<testcase>
<info>
<keywords>
HTTP
HTTP proxy
NO_PROXY
noproxy
</keywords>
</info>
# Server-side
<reply>
<data>
HTTP/1.1 200 OK
Date: Thu, 09 Nov 2010 14:49:00 GMT
Server: test-server/fake
Content-Length: 4
Content-Type: text/html
foo
</data>
</reply>
# Client-side
<client>
<server>
http
</server>
<name>
Under condition using --proxy, override NO_PROXY by --nproxy and access target URL directly
</name>
<setenv>
NO_PROXY=example.com
</setenv>
<command>
http://%HOSTIP:%HTTPPORT/1252 --proxy http://%HOSTIP:%HTTPPORT --noproxy %HOSTIP
</command>
</client>
# Verify data after the test has been "shot"
<verify>
<strip>
^User-Agent:.*
</strip>
<protocol>
GET /1252 HTTP/1.1
Host: %HOSTIP:%HTTPPORT
Accept: */*
</protocol>
</verify>
</testcase>
